Summary : A compatibility layer for windows applications
Description :
Wine as a compatibility layer for UNIX to run Windows applications. This
package includes a program loader, which allows unmodified Windows
3.x/9x/NT binaries to run on x86 and x86_64 Unixes. Wine can use native system
.dll files if they are available.
In Fedora wine is a meta-package which will install everything needed for wine
to work smoothly. Smaller setups can be achieved by installing some of the
wine-* sub packages.

Update Information:
* Support for kernel job objects.
* Various fixes to the ListView control.
* Better support for OOB data in Windows Sockets.
* Support for DIB images in the OLE data cache.
* Improved support for MSI patches.
* Some fixes for ACL file permissions.
* Various bug fixes.
